Overview

Frank Der Yuen was a globally recognized aeronautical engineer, airline executive, and consultant. A graduate of Harvard and MIT, he engineered the all-weather, self-propelled passenger boarding bridges found at major airports worldwide. Mr. Der Yuen served as Executive Director of the Honolulu Airlines Committee and as a vice president of Aloha Airlines. He contributed to the design of the Daniel K. Inouye (Honolulu) International Airport and helped establish the Pacific Aerospace Museum formerly located there.

Intro and Purpose
From its earliest days, NDTA has prioritized promoting and supporting education, research, science, and development in transportation across private, industrial, academic, and government sectors. To provide a dedicated funding vehicle for those efforts, the Association created the NDTA Foundation in 1961 as a separate financial entity operating under NDTA. A volunteer Board of Trustees oversees the Foundation’s work.

How the Foundation is Supported
The Foundation relies on voluntary contributions. Donations are tax-deductible under Section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code. Contributions are restricted to Foundation-related purposes and may not be used to cover unrelated operating expenses.

Overview
The American Association of University Women (AAUW) works to promote equity for women and girls through advocacy, education, philanthropy and research. Aligned with this mission, the Atascadero Branch of AAUW awards scholarships each year to women who have completed at least one year of college at an accredited institution and who either live in North County or attended high school there. In recent years, individual awards have typically ranged from $500 to $2,000.

Equity and opportunity for women and girls are central to AAUW’s purpose nationally and within our branch. Through our branch Charitable Foundation, we award the Doris Karlik Local Scholarships to women of Palm Beach County who are beginning or continuing undergraduate study. We also select and sponsor a local student to attend AAUW’s annual National Conference for College Women Student Leaders (NCCWSL) in Maryland. Scholarship recipients and the NCCWSL designee are recognized at our annual installation dinner in May.

Introduction
Each year the Scholarship Fund of the Minneapolis Branch of AAUW provides four-year college scholarships to women graduating from Minneapolis public high schools. Awards are intended for students who plan to earn a Baccalaureate degree at an accredited college or university and who demonstrate both financial need and academic readiness for college-level work.

Eligibility
- Graduate of any Minneapolis Public High School
- Minimum cumulative GPA of 3.0
- Demonstrated financial need
- Intention to pursue a Baccalaureate degree at an accredited institution
- Evidence of success in college-level coursework (for example: IB, AP, PSEO, CIS, etc.)
